Kettlebells build strength while expressing said strength on an object. Body weight builds strength while expressing said strength on yourself. Disinviting (sort of) #2 Barbells build strength by perfecting one movement groove (the squat, for example). Body weight builds strength by increasing movement complexity (leverage and positioning).

A difference between clubs and kettlebells is the grip. With kettlebells you work on the hook grip, which is a form of support grip, but a club tries to slip out of your hand so you must crush it. I think support grip lasts longer and is generally stronger, so the regular kind of training with kettlebells is made easier ...Fitness. 7 Best Kettlebell Exercises to Include in Your Workout. Kettlebell Kings Powder Coat - Kettlebell Kings powder coat kettlebells offer an excellent balance between durability and usability. They have a very smooth finish with a powder coating that feels like chalk has already been applied to it. They’re very easy to use for extended periods without needing chalk.

Competition kettlebells are limited in weight because the rules specify the size (volume) of the kettlebell. You can only fit so much iron in a given volume. I know Kettlebell Kings have some with lead cores to give them even more density but it’s still a set max volume.

The towel allows you to train a hammer curl at the bottom of the rep, then supinate as you come through the rep getting the benefits of a regular dumbbell curl at the top of the rep. And then you can bunch up the towel as much as you want to train grip at the same time too. Essentially it’s like a fat-gripz-rope-extension-cable-curl. 4.
